Getting a certificate error.  I switched ISP's recently.  Would that be the reason?

sun.security.validator.ValidatorException: PKIX path validation failed: java.security.cert.CertPathValidatorException: timestamp check failed
javax.net.ssl.SSLHandshakeException: sun.security.validator.ValidatorException: PKIX path validation failed: java.security.cert.CertPathValidatorException: timestamp check failed
this could indicate, that your system time is not in sync with global time servers..
try to synchronize your system time with global time servers

If you do not manage to fix this, there is an option in the settings to suppress SSL errors

EDIT: okay, looks like the certs from https://assets.fanart.tv are broken - I get the same error in my browser

I'm also trying to rescrape ratings only for the nfo files using the Kodi Universal Movie Scraper.  This scaper has the omdb api option to grab the rotten tomatoes ratings.  I've tried using the scape metadata option but I get an error stating could not scrape - no supported ID available.  I also tried rescraping the movie and it's not behaving as I expect.  If I highlight multiple movies choosing rescrape forcing best match it only does one.  If I do it without forcing best match it will pull up each movie properly but it always defaults to themoviedb.org, so I have to manually change it to Kodi universal scraper each movie even though I have selected the Kodi Universal scraper in the settings.  This makes it very tedious to update each movie.  Is there an easy way to update the nfo's to get the rotten tomatoes ratings for every movie automatically leaving the other items in the nfo alone?

why do you use the Kodi universal scraper? 

a) tmm has an own OMDB scraper
b) tmm has an own universal scraper

and both should work out of the box..

I cannot say why the Kodi universal scraper throws an "no supported ID available" error, but since they are not maintained by us, we barely such for errors there (especially since we offer many things by tmm itself)

EDIT: okay just figured out why you get this error - the Kodi scrapers are built to search and then get the meta data. They're not as flexible as tmm scrapers (to be called just with an given ID to get the meta data for that ID).. Since you do not search with the same Kodi scraper before, you are not able to scrape meta data with it
